// Thumbnail generation queue depth for the Oatrun plugin host.
// Plugins MUST NOT assume synchronous thumbnail delivery; jobs
// are batched and may lag under load. Exceeding this depth causes
// older jobs to be dropped silently, so size your requests
// accordingly. Do not override this constant in plugin code —
// it is pinned per release of the Oatrun core. The pinned release
// is identified by the token below.

trace token, fafog-kageg: htk4_98e6

Handover for tonight: the roof-terrace door at Pellam Tower is still jamming past the halfway point. Maintenance looked at it Tuesday and adjusted the hinge, but it's sticking again in the damp. Give it a firm shoulder push rather than forcing the handle. If you need to prop it for the smoke test, disarm the alarm first with the code below.

staff pass of kagef-yahip = bdg-TKELFT-63915354

## Key Ceremony Checklist — Item 7: Profile Store Shard Keys

Before you approve this, double-check that the shard-split keys for the Tambry user-profile store were generated on the air-gapped laptop, not someone's dev box (yes, it happened once). Each of the four shard custodians should have signed the ceremony log, and the old monolith key must be marked retired. The escrow envelope for shard rebalancing gets sealed last. When the reviewer countersigns, write the recovery passphrase on the line that follows.

vault phrase of bagaf-kajeg = jorath-feniel-briir-siliel-ralix